What a fire-rated roll-up door in fact does

A fire-rated roll-up door is a barrier, a timer, and a website traffic police. Throughout normal procedures, it imitates any rolling steel door, riding up within guides, curling on a barrel over the opening. In a fire occasion, it disconnects from day-to-day security devices and changes to a top priority: close controlled, seal off the opening, and quit flame and warm spread for a ranked time. Rankings usually range from 45 mins to 4 hours, validated by a screening lab listing. In combined occupancies or along fire hallways, this acquires critical minutes for emptying and for firemans to position.

Most fire-rated roll-up doors include numerous layers of redundancy. A fusible link, usually adjusted to thaw around 165 levels Fahrenheit, will certainly launch the door if convected heat increases around the setting up. On top of that, a launch device interfaces with the smoke alarm system, so a detector throughout the area or a signal from the main panel will go down the door even if warm has actually not reached the opening. For mechanized doors, the driver needs to stop working safely, permitting gravity to close the drape with a guv that keeps descent speed predictable, commonly within a range that people can relocate away from.

If you function around these doors each day, remember that appearances are second. Thin-gauge slats that look streamlined but oil-can under pressure will not stand up in a ranked setting up. For fire doors, slat geometry, endlocks, and overview depth matter due to the fact that they assist the curtain resist deflection under warm and air pressure. The outcome is unglamorous however robust. That is what you desire safeguarding a fire barrier.

Integration with your life-safety systems

The adversary resides in the circuitry and the signage. A fire-rated roll-up door is only as wise as its connections and individuals who comprehend them.

Tie-ins usually happen using a launching device that takes a completely dry call signal from the emergency alarm panel. On alarm, daily-use safety and security functions such as photo-eyes and edge sensors are bypassed, since you do not desire a stray pallet or forklift fork preventing closure in a true occasion. The descent speed is regulated mechanically, not online, so also a power failure must not quit closure after release.

Common problem places show up repeatedly in Business Garage Door Solution calls:

  • The releasing gadget is powered from a circuit that is not managed, so a tripped breaker silences the device without signaling the panel. A quick checkup by your alarm service provider and a coordinated examination with your garage door team prevents this.
  • Audio-visual pre-close cautions, like a buzzer and sign, obtain wired for everyday cycles however not for alarm system launch. In a genuine occasion, they stay dark and silent. That shocks people during drills and can cause hazardous reactions near the opening.
  • The driver's brake drags, or the governor was never ever adjusted properly. You see a door that sneaks down, then unexpectedly rises. That is a warning for Commercial garage door repair, not a quirk to tolerate.

I advise you set up a seen alarm-initiated decline a minimum of yearly, straightened with NFPA 80's requirement for annual assessment, testing, and recordkeeping. The right team will certainly record the drop rate, reset steps, and any kind of restorative actions. It is not attractive, however it is the foundation of responsible garage door fixing and compliance.

Choosing the best door for the opening

Every production line and corridor informs its very own tale. Focus on a few qualities before you validate Industrial Garage Door Installation for a rated roll-up.

Size precedes. Wider than 10 feet, wind loads and deflection become a bigger deal in day-to-day usage. Choose much deeper guides and much heavier evaluates so the drape resists racking https://emilianoywtz294.theglensecret.com/fireking-fire-rated-roll-up-doors-commercial-garage-door-solution-that-boosts-protection-1 when a forklift blasts by with air motion, although wind score is not the main purpose in a fire obstacle. At heights over 14 feet, counterbalance ability and barrel diameter influence service area over the opening. If you just have 18 inches of headroom before you struck a pipe chase, obtain your installer to confirm coil measurements and operator clearances in writing.

Fire rating matters due to context. Along a demising wall surface in between a production area and a workplace hallway, I commonly see 90 minute requirements. In a fire wall surface that divides structures or fire areas, 3 hours is not uncommon. The listing will certainly show up on the tag and the submittals, and inspectors will check both. If your space includes industrial food preparation or raised ambient temperatures, ask your installer to swap typical 165 level fusible links for 212 degree links on doors situated directly throughout from heat resources. That little choice prevents nuisance releases without compromising protection.

Materials and coatings are functional decisions. Galvanized steel slats are the workhorse, with baked-on polyester paint when customers desire color coding. Stainless-steel shows up in food production, however it adds cost and does not change the demand for a fire listing. Light weight aluminum is common in routine moving doors yet not in fire-rated drapes. Do not chat yourself right into a lightweight light weight aluminum remedy where a detailed steel assembly is required.

Finally, everyday usage matters. If the opening is utilized loads of times per hour, the operator and springing demand to support high cycles. Request for 50,000 cycle torsion springs instead of 20,000. When I run a lifecycle expense comparison, the upcharge pays for itself in decreased spring modifications over 5 to seven years.

The craft of installation

A strong item installed improperly is a weak system. Throughout Commercial Garage Door Installation, I look for alignment, add-on, and clearances like a hawk. Guides has to be plumb within small tolerances, or the drape will bind and chatter, eventually chewing out endlocks. Fasteners require to hit framework, not simply block. On steel jambs or tube steel, powder-actuated fasteners and through-bolts are both legit, as long as the installer understands the architectural course and the producer's instructions. On stonework, sleeve anchors must be appropriately installed, with torque verified.

Operator positioning usually obtains improvised in the field. Withstand that. Center mount versus wall surface place adjustments lots paths. Chain lifts need straight declines without rubbing on angle structures. Control terminals must be mounted at available heights, with clear signs that identifies fire launch from day-to-day open and close commands.

Tuning matters. Establish quit limitations so the door does not slam hard into the flooring, which presses the lower bar seal and results in very early failure. Validate governor setups throughout installment, not simply at the very first annual test. If I can, I arrange a real-time demonstration with site team existing. Seeing a technician launch and reset a fire door when sticks with individuals much better than reading a binder later.

Maintenance that redeems your time

The everyday indignities a storehouse dishes out are genuine. Forks scrape overviews. Dust cakes on counterbalance springs. Puddles rust bottom bars. This is where Business Garage Door Service makes its keep.

I framework upkeep around cycles and environment. High-cycle doors obtain quarterly visits. Low-cycle doors in tidy passages could only need semiannual checks. At each go to, the technology should check slats for dings and endlock wear, verify guide fasteners are snug, lubricate bearings with the appropriate weight, and cycle the operator to pay attention for adjustments. On fire doors particularly, I desire eyes on release wires, fusible links, and the emergency alarm user interface factors. Replace a torn cord or a heat-exposed web link long before it fails.

None of this replaces the annual fire door decline examination required by NFPA 80. That test includes a full decline under fire launch problems, a reset, and a 2nd drop to confirm proper resetting. Record the date, the door place, the examination results, and any kind of repairs. Keep copies near the door and in your life-safety binder. Examiners will ask, and you do not wish to rely on somebody's memory during a walk-through.

When something fails during an alarm

Things occur. A lower bar snags on a misaligned drainpipe grate. A guide takes a ding from a forklift and squeezes the slats. A brake sticks in winter. In the field, you create a feel for triage.

If a door is reluctant, do not allow any individual get under the curtain to explore while it is descending. Once it reaches the flooring or rests securely half down under guidance, a trained tech can seek a proud screw head or a pinched endlock. Sometimes, we loosen two overview fasteners, touch the overview true with a rubber mallet, and retighten to free the drape. If the governor lets the door increase too quickly, treat it as a service threat. Lock the door out, reset with care, and routine immediate adjustment.

I have actually also seen problem releases where warm from an adjacent oven area cooks the fusible link just sufficient to go down the door in peak manufacturing. It irritates every person up until somebody checks the link score and the door's area in regard to venting. Switching to a higher temperature level fusible web link within the listing and guidance resolves the problem.

Edge instances and special conditions

No 2 centers are identical, and some areas challenge regular assumptions.

Cold storage space requires focus to condensation. Wetness gathers and freezes at the bottom bar and guides. I define heaters on operators and sometimes guide heaters in severe instances. Gasketing assists, but careful drain around the sill matters more.

Hospitals and institutions are delicate to unchecked closures. Assimilation must include pre-close warning gadgets that in fact activate in alarm launch setting. Team training is nonnegotiable. I have actually strolled institution center groups via resets until the muscular tissue memory is trustworthy, because a door stuck shut along a service corridor throughout a lunch thrill creates unnecessary pressure.

Mixed retail and back-of-house brings looks into play. Powder-coated slats and shrouded hoods can look clean without giving up listing or function. Simply do not let style gain clear tags and accessibility. You still require room to service the guv and the operator.

High wind zones are not a fire-door spec, yet openings along exterior wall surfaces occasionally try to do double duty. Maintain the ranges separate. Use ranked wind-load rolling doors for outside protection, and fire-rated roll-ups where the structure's fire-resistance strategy needs it. Expect a conversation with your engineer to ensure the accessories and guides bring both duties when unavoidable.
